Key data from North Ayrshire
From 1 April to 30 September 2023 we have supported a number of employers and 104 individuals dealing with redundancy.
As of 29 September 2023 there were 1,079 Modern Apprentices in training.
From 1 April to 29 September 2023 we supported 344 Modern Apprenticeship starts. 64.5% of the starts in the local area were aged 16-24.
The Modern Apprenticeship achievement rate in North Ayrshire is 80.0%.
From 1 June to 30 September 2023 we delivered 4,318 Career Information, Advice and Guidance engagements for 4,005 school pupils through a mix of group and one-to-one sessions.
As at the 30 September 2023 of the 6,540 maintained school pupils in the local authority, 68% were registered on myworldofwork.co.uk.
From 1 April to 30 September 2023 we delivered 651 Career Information, Advice and Guidance engagements for 404 post-school customers through a mix of group and one-to-one sessions.
The 2023 Annual Participation Measure showed that of the 5,872 16-19 year olds in North Ayrshire 93.9% were in education, employment or training and personal development.
In 2021-22 there were 20 registered Graduate Apprentices with a home address in the local authority and 16 registered with employers based in the area.
In 2021-22, 43 pupils started Foundation Apprenticeships in schools at SCQF Level 4-6 in this area.
In 2021-22 we invested over £5.2m in the local area.
